Abstract
Mining companies require accurate short-term mining forecasts to meet budget targets and customer needs. Challenging mining conditions along with employee turnover and lack of standard geologic modeling and mine planning processes can result in time-consuming and inconsistent mine plans. Documentation and automation of the processes involved in mine planning, as well as proper software utilization, are critical in overcoming these challenges. This paper discusses the steps involved in achieving an optimized mine planning system to accomplish productive and cost effective operations. In addition, a case study is included to describe the process of implementing a semi-automated system whereby the geologic model and mine scheduling database are updated monthly to incorporate changes in geology in a relatively complex open-pit coal mine. This case study proves that the ability to update geologic models based on the latest information gathered from production drilling and mining activities can greatly enhance the ability to accurately predict short-term mining production.
